Definition
UNSPSC 51433938This classification denotes a calcium channel blocker with the molecular formula C17H18N2O6.ClH, a preparation that US FDA regulates as an active ingredient or moiety under Unique Ingredient Identifier 9626V3KSPM, chemically known as 3,5-pyridinedicarboxylic acid, 1,4-dihydro-2,6-dimethyl-4-(2-nitrophenyl)-, 3,5-dimethyl ester, hydrochloride (1:1), but more generally known as nifedipine hydrochloride, which bears US NIH Compound Identifier 63011. European Medicines Agency schedules nifedipine hydrochloride or its base in its eXtended EudraVigilance Medicinal Product Dictionary or XEVMPD under Index SUB09253MIG. Most nations, for tariff purposes, schedule nifedipine hydrochloride under HS 29333999. SMILES: CC1=C(C(C(=C(N1)C)C(=O)OC)C2CCCCC2[N+](=O)[O-])C(=O)OC.CL.
